Kinds of Windows


The marketplace is filled with different types of windows, each designed to meet various aesthetic and functional requirements. Understanding the distinctions among these types can assist homeowners make informed decisions.

Kind of Window

Description

Advantages

Single-Hung

Only the bottom sash moves; top sash is repaired.

Affordable; easy to preserve.

Double-Hung

Both sashes move, permitting improved ventilation.

Versatile; easier to clean.

Moving

Sashes slide horizontally.

Space-saving; simple operation.

Casement

Hinged window that swings open from the side.

Excellent ventilation; unobstructed views.

Awning

Hinged on top and opens external.

Reliable rain protection; great ventilation.

Bay

Composed of three windows, usually featuring a center window that extends.

Offers breathtaking views; includes architectural interest.

Picture

A big fixed window that doesn't open.

Maximizes natural light; provides unblocked views.

Preparing for Window Installation


Before embarking on a window installation project, appropriate preparation is crucial. Here are the crucial steps to think about:

  1. Measure the Window Opening:

    • Accurate measurements are vital for a successful installation. Carefully determine the height and width of the window opening and keep in mind the depth of any existing trim.
  2. Select the Right Windows:

    • Based on the measurements and the kind of window preferred, select windows that satisfy your visual and functional requirements. Think about energy ratings and materials.
  3. Collect Tools and Materials:

    • Having the right tools on hand will make the installation process smoother. Common tools include:
      • Tape step
      • Level
      • Screwdriver
      • Hammer
      • Caulk weapon
      • Shims
